Health Care Network 2025 - 2026 Associate
 
 
 
Increase community awareness and assist in developing strategic partnerships. Assist clinic leaders with data collection and analysis, create engaging outreach strategies to increase community awareness.

Member Duties : Assist in preparing grant reports, data dissemination, grant proposals and information requests from community partners. Attend community outreach events. Create visually appealing way to tell the story of the need for free clinics. Assist in planning special events. Create social media posts with targeted messages to patients, volunteers, donors, and community partners. Assist in updating agency website as needed. Learn usage electronic medical record system, including reporting functions. Assist with “closing” on-site clinic to ensure follow up care. Assist with collection of outcome data. Assist with clinical program development. Update clinical policy and procedure manual as needed. Maintain patient confidentiality. Maintain a “team player” attitude
 
Program Benefits : Health Coverage ,  Living Allowance ,  Childcare assistance if eligible ,  Stipend ,  Training ,  Education award upon successful completion of service .
